Zakopane Tatra Mountains
Zakopane is located in the heart of the Tatra Mountains and is the so-called “winter capital of Poland”. It has a reputation of a perfect winter resort with a vibrant cultural life. Located just 100 km (60 miles) from Kraków, it is a very popular destination for holidays. Zakopane attracts with the proximity of beautiful mountain trails and its original folklore. In summer, Zakopane impresses with its many valleys, peaks and ponds, and in winter with excellent ski conditions.

There are many things to do in Zakopane. Almost every mountain trail is just a short walk from the city centre. The most popular place for hiking is Gubałówka, a mountain famous for its beautiful panorama. Tourists often also choose Kasprowy Wierch, which can be reached by tram. Giewont is also popular – a massif in the shape of a sleeping soldier who, according to the legend, will wake up to protect his homeland during the danger. Near Zakopane there are numerous mountain ponds and valleys.
It is worth visiting the city of Zakopane, also to admire its original architecture and local folklore. Krupówki, one-kilometre long main street, is crowded with small stalls offering traditional dishes, such as smoked sheep cheese – “oscypek”. You can also buy typical souvenirs like “ciupaga” (shepherd’s axe) or leather shoes called “kierpce”.
